How correlated are ACB and IGC?

On 3 years of weekly data the ACB/IGC correlation comes out at 0.44, moderate. The link has tightened recently: the 1-year correlation (0.60) runs above the 3-year figure (0.44). The 5-year figure is 0.44, and annualized covariance runs at 2848.4 %².

Within ACB's tracked universe of 15 assets, IGC comes in at #5 by 3-year correlation. Neither side won the trailing year by much: -24.8% against -25.8%.

How is this computed?

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

What does a correlation of 0.44 mean?

On the −1 to +1 scale, 0.44 describes how much the two returns move together: +1 is lockstep, 0 is independence, negative values mean opposite directions. It says nothing about which performed better.
